What is Sweden Government Debt? Government debt, also known as public debt or national debt, refers to the amount of money that a government owes to various creditors, both domestic and foreign. This debt is accumulated through borrowing to finance various expenditures, such as infrastructure projects, social welfare programs, and budget deficits. In Sweden's case, government debt includes both central government debt and local government debt.
Interpreting Sweden Government Debt: 1. Debt-to-GDP Ratio: One commonly used indicator to assess the sustainability of government debt is the debt-to-GDP ratio. This ratio compares the total government debt to the country's Gross Domestic Product (GDP). A higher debt-to-GDP ratio indicates a larger debt burden relative to the size of the economy, potentially posing risks to economic stability.
2. Historical Trends: Assessing the historical trend of Sweden government debt provides insights into the country's fiscal discipline and debt management practices. Analyzing fluctuations, growth, or reduction in debt levels over time helps identify patterns and evaluate the effectiveness of previous policies.
3. Interest Rates: Monitoring the interest rates on government debt is vital, as it directly affects the government's borrowing costs. Rising interest rates increase the cost of servicing the debt and may lead to a higher debt burden.
4. Credit Ratings: Credit rating agencies evaluate a country's creditworthiness by assessing its ability to repay debt. Monitoring Sweden's credit ratings provides an indication of investor confidence and influences borrowing costs for the government.
